16 cities. 30 days. One increasingly hard to follow rule.
Simon is a rule-follower by nature. He always drives the speed limit, he never litters, and he honors the "Oregon Rule"--no getting involved with anyone you're on tour with. It's worth it to protect the found family of his band, The Boy Scouts of Atlantis.
And it's never been a problem for him until they start touring with the all-girl band Queen Anne. Because their guitarist, Marlowe, is beautiful and funny and dangerously talented.
Every day, Marlowe's band is getting closer to going full-time. But it's difficult for Marlowe to focus on that goal with Simon singing into the mic that way, making her laugh, and moving his fingers over the frets of his guitar in ways that send her imagination into overdrive.
Neither of them want to keep secrets from the rest of their bandmates, but it's getting harder to ignore the chemistry between them. As Simon and Marlowe and their bands make their way through California and Oregon, they're forced to decide what rules are worth breaking, and who they're worth breaking them for.
